Activity 9-2: Hydraulic Stage Lifting System
A theater company has hired an engineering consulting firm to design a hydraulic system to lift and hold a section of a stage for a given amount of time. The section of the stage that must be lifted and held weighs 2900 lb . The cylinder has a piston diameter of 2.25 in .
Connect Schematic Symbols to indicate a schematic diagram that shows the lifting and holding operation.
How much pressure is required to lift the load?
How much pressure is required to hold the load in position?
What is the amount of spring biasing pressure in the counterbalance valve?
